    Infrastructure financing for urban water management to modernize supply, sanitation and introduce performance-based private operation.
    A loan-funded program will modernize and expand urban water supply and sanitation in selected Karnataka towns, financing treatment capacity, transmission and distribution works, storage reservoirs, household metered connections and sewer rehabilitation, together with IT-based town supervisory control and community demand-management activities to promote efficient water use. The program also uses a performance-based construct and operate contract (PBCOC) model to allocate operational risk between public agencies and private operators and includes institutional strengthening of urban local bodies to improve utility responsiveness and service sustainability.

    Loan agreement to finance upgrading of state highways advances road safety and institutional capacity building.
    A Loan Agreement between the Government of India and the Asian Development Bank finances upgrading about 230 kilometres of State Highways in Bihar to a minimum two lane standard with paved shoulders and road safety features, and mandates reconstruction and strengthening of culverts and bridges while establishing a State level Road Research Institute to build road agency technical and management capacity.

    Exchange of information standards strengthened under tax treaty protocol, aligning measures with BEPS minimum standards.
    Amendment to the Double Taxation Avoidance Agreement revises the treaty's exchange of information provisions to meet current international standards and incorporates modifications to implement treaty related minimum standards from the BEPS Action reports, along with additional BEPS-consistent changes agreed by the parties to enhance transparency and prevent fiscal evasion.

    Infrastructure financing advances for state power upgrade enabling transmission, smart metering and institutional strengthening under multilateral loan.
    A multilateral Loan Agreement finances the Jharkhand Power System Improvement Project to expand and modernize transmission infrastructure, deploy automated substations and network planning tools, strengthen State Load Dispatch Centre operations for renewable integration, and install smart meters with two-way communication and backend IT to reduce losses and improve peak load management while supporting institutional capacity building of State-owned utilities.

    Multitranche financing expands hydropower transmission capacity, enabling power evacuation and strengthening state utility operational and institutional capacity.
    Tranche three financing under a multi tranche financing facility will expand Himachal Pradesh's transmission network to evacuate hydropower, support institutional capacity development of the state transmission utility as executing agency, and increase transmission capacity to benefit consumers and sustain developer confidence; the loan features a long-term amortisation, a specified grace period, an interest rate linked to an interbank benchmark, and a commitment charge.

    Climate-resilient urban water infrastructure expands piped water and sewerage services while strengthening operational capacity and governance.
    The Government of India and the Asian Development Bank entered a multitranche financing arrangement to fund climate-resilient urban water, sewerage, and drainage infrastructure in Tamil Nadu, with an initial loan tranche and accompanying grants and technical assistance. The program targets upgraded piped water and sewerage connections, climate-adapted sewerage collection and treatment, drainage improvements, and a solar-powered sewage treatment pilot, while coupling investment with smart water management, capacity building, public-awareness, and governance strengthening to expand service coverage and operational efficiency.

    Fintech infrastructure enabling universal digital identity and interoperable payments, expanding inclusion while prioritising security and data governance.
    India's fintech approach builds public digital infrastructure-biometric identity, near universal bank accounts, interoperable payment rails and open APIs-to deliver direct transfers, expand credit via algorithmic decisioning, digitise procurement, and enable rapid lending to micro and small enterprises, while emphasising cyber resilience, AML controls, data governance and consumer protections to ensure inclusive, trustworthy scale and international platform connectivity.

    Formalisation of the economy expanded the tax base and accelerated digital payments, boosting compliance and recorded transactions.
    Demonetisation compelled cash into banks, enabling identification of holders and increasing taxable disclosures; combined with technology-driven tax administration, financial inclusion measures and GST, this formalisation expanded the tax base, raised direct and indirect tax collections, and accelerated adoption of digital payment systems, thereby increasing recorded economic activity and enabling greater public expenditure on infrastructure and social programmes.

    Advance Pricing Agreement expansion secures greater transfer pricing certainty as CBDT signs additional unilateral and bilateral APAs.
    The Central Board of Direct Taxes has executed additional Unilateral and Bilateral Advance Pricing Agreements covering diverse sectors and international transactions-including software services, back-office support, trade in inputs, royalty and marketing payments, distribution, corporate and business support services, and guarantee fees-aimed at fostering a non-adversarial tax regime and enhancing transfer pricing certainty through timely APA conclusions.
